Will

Will (Ref., Piece, Image) Will Dates Intestate Probate Dates Administration Dates Comments
A William Love, Bookseller, Stationer and Librarian of Saint Luke, Middlesex = PROB 11/1738; Sutton Quire Numbers: 151-200; Im.Ref.54/55; 15 Mar 1828. ---

Events (3)

Date Event type Description
5 Sep 1775 Bound to Joseph Smith (LBT/19981)
2 Dec 1777 Turned-over first - on the death of Smith, to Francis Blyth (LBT/21736)
1 Oct 1782 Freed - Servitude - by Francis Blyth (LBT/21736)
